Output 66bec3edf0d8e38a398c319fa52128c5a19f736ac20035a39901c92b7b38268e:7

value
678928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a192a95e855e8867d9e75c955fc72696f3f116da OP_EQUAL
address
3GRLQewYv4RB866v3XirU6ArZwn8c8U2Cp
transaction
66bec3edf0d8e38a398c319fa52128c5a19f736ac20035a39901c92b7b38268e
confirmations
171000
spent
true